Ferne McCann says it's 'strange but wonderful' to be living with new boyfriend Jack

Ferne McCann confirmed she is spending the third lockdown with her new boyfriend Jack Padgett.

Appearing on Wednesday's edition of Loose Women, the former Towie star revealed she is now living with the model - who she met last year.

The 30 year old was on the ITV show to discuss her appearance on Celebrity Best Home Cook, when the conversation turned to romance.

Brenda Edwards was keen to ask Ferne about her new boyfriend, which is when the mum-of-one revealed they are now living under one roof.

"We decided to do lockdown together, which is a really big deal for me ladies!" Ferne told the panel.

"I did lockdown one as a single woman, and now I’m living with a guy! It's strange and wonderful and new all at the same time."

Ruth Langsford was quick to comment that Jack is a "lucky man" to be living with Ferne and her cooking skills.

Ferne, who started dating Jack last year, recently told The Mirror she’s the happiest she’s been in a while.

Speaking about the romance, she said: "It’s very early days. We’ll see how it goes.

"I've done a lot of self-work to get myself mentally strong and right now, I feel happy and content."

She added: "Food is the way to my heart. If a man wants to impress me, a perfect date would be going to have food with someone."

Ferne also revealed how cooking has been "therapy" for her after a tough few years which saw her ex Arthur Collins – the father of her three-year-old daughter Sunday – jailed for an acid attack.

“Cooking is emotional for me,” says Ferne. “It has been my therapy. It calms me.

“When I’ve had a bad day, I pour myself some vino, listen to some jazz and get my cook on.”
